Bill Lozanovski is a scholar working on Automotive Engineering, Mechanical Engineering and Biomedical Engineering. According to data from OpenAlex, Bill Lozanovski has authored 18 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Automotive Engineering, 14 papers in Mechanical Engineering and 5 papers in Biomedical Engineering. Recurrent topics in Bill Lozanovski's work include Additive Manufacturing and 3D Printing Technologies (15 papers), Additive Manufacturing Materials and Processes (8 papers) and Cellular and Composite Structures (8 papers). Bill Lozanovski is often cited by papers focused on Additive Manufacturing and 3D Printing Technologies (15 papers), Additive Manufacturing Materials and Processes (8 papers) and Cellular and Composite Structures (8 papers). Bill Lozanovski collaborates with scholars based in Australia, United States and South Africa. Bill Lozanovski's co-authors include Milan Brandt, Martin Leary, Ma Qian, Xuezhe Zhang, Tobias Maconachie, Omar Faruque, Peter Choong, Darpan Shidid, Phuong Tran and David Downing and has published in prestigious journals such as Materials & Design, Additive manufacturing and The International Journal of Advanced Manufacturing Technology.
